What legal action can be taken after account freeze?

My account at IndusInd Bank in Bhuj was frozen on 01/04/2024.

Contact IndusInd Bank's 24x7 customer care or visit your Bhuj branch immediately to understand the specific reason for the account freeze (like KYC update, suspicious activity, court order etc.). Once you know the reason, submit all required documents to the branch to get your account reactivated - this could include updated ID proof, address proof, income proof or any other documentation they request.
